How they compare
Sierra Leone currently reports 50.3% against 35.7% in Belize, a difference of 14.6%.
That makes Sierra Leone's figure about 1.4 times Belize's.
Across all 5 years both countries report, Sierra Leone has been ahead every year.
Belize ranks 66th and Sierra Leone ranks 64th of 67 countries.
Sierra Leone has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
